Mandragora: Whispers of the Witch Tree - Future Games Show Trailer | PS5 Games

52K views

PlayStation

4 days ago

Mandragora: Whispers of the Witch Tree - Future Games Show Trailer | PS5 Games

Mandragora: Whispers of the Witch Tree - Future Games Show Trailer | PS5 Games